Download the Audio Show FileNew YouTube Channel – Beyond the OfficeFull Summary:In this episode titled “The AGI Standoff Is Already Happening,” host Todd Cochrane discusses a significant policy paper co-authored by Eric Schmidt, Alexander Wang, and Dan Hendricks, which cautions against the creation of a Manhattan Project-style initiative for artificial general intelligence (AGI). Cochrane expresses skepticism about the authors’ perspective, arguing that an AGI race is already underway despite their claims. He emphasizes the risk of a global AI arms race, likening it to the historical atomic arms race and questioning whether rivals would accept a strategic imbalance in AI development. Cochrane believes the existing competition and investment in AGI development among nations indicate that the standoff is already in motion.
